Yea, thats the bit im looking forward to the most Andy!

And yea, i fully expect to spin a lot of times, it was hard enough getting used to kicking the clutch and not spinning it- using weight transfer to initiate i was used to, and let Kenny drive my car and was initiating drifts with clutch kicks with so little effort it was unbelivable, so i did it, and the car just went right round almost on the spot

Need to countersteer even before youve done it, and the handbrake is gonna be the same i think

No video camera, but its high on by to-buy list, i got sooo much highly illegal street drifting that needs filming, lol

Figures? I dunno, not loads to be honest, 250odd with the intercooler etc on?

Dont need power really, just a good suspension n diff setup to drift, and lots of bottle, lol.
Want about 300-330bhp in near future, but mainly torque and instant responce, thats most important.
